(PHP Extension) Create a Zip Entirely in MemoryDemonstrates how to create a .zip from in-memory byte data and strings, and to write the .zip to an in-memory image. Note: This example requires Chilkat v11.0.0 or greater.
<?php include("chilkat.php"); $success = false; // This example requires the Chilkat API to have been previously unlocked. // See Global Unlock Sample for sample code. $crypt = new CkCrypt2(); $zip = new CkZip(); $success = $zip->NewZip('test.zip'); if ($success == false) { print $zip->lastErrorText() . "\n"; exit; } // Add the bytes 0x00 0x01 0x02 0x03 ... 0x0F as a file in the .zip $bd = new CkBinData(); $bd->AppendEncoded('000102030405060708090A0B0C0D0E0F','hex'); $zip->AddBd('binaryData.dat',$bd); // Add the string "Hello World!" to the .zip $zip->AddString('helloWorld.txt','Hello World!','utf-8'); $zipFileInMemory = new CkByteData(); $success = $zip->WriteToMemory($zipFileInMemory); // We could save these files to a file, and it is a valid .zip $fac = new CkFileAccess(); $success = $fac->WriteEntireFile('test.zip',$zipFileInMemory); if ($success == false) { print $fac->lastErrorText() . "\n"; exit; } print 'Zip Created!' . "\n"; ?> |
